Female vulvar leukoplakia usually causes vulvar itching , sometimes with burning and pain . The skin of the affected area is rough, thickened like moss , with scratches , and sometimes chapped . Local pigmentation is reduced , and the labia majora and labia minora generally turn white . Mild atrophy can be seen on the vulva. In severe cases , the clitoris, labia majora and labia minora shrink and adhere, and the labia minora disappears partially or completely , and then tightens , the vaginal opening becomes narrow and loses elasticity , and even affects urination and sexual life .
